Bodega clerk Jose Alba ditching NYC for Dominican Republic after murder charge dropped
NY Post ^ | August 5, 2022 | Oumou Fofana, Georgett Roberts and Gabrielle Fonrouge

Posted on 08/07/2022 7:25:42 AM PDT by DoodleBob

The bodega clerk who was infamously charged with murder for fatally stabbing an assailant has had it with the crime-ridden Big Apple and is returning to the Dominican Republic, pals told The Post on Friday.

“He doesn’t work here anymore. He’s getting ready to move out of the country,” the manager of the Blue Moon convenience store, where the grisly Manhattan stabbing happened July 1, said of Jose Alba, 61.

The store manager, who declined to identify himself, said Alba is headed to Santiago, a city in the Dominican Republic where the former worker is originally from.

...

Alba is still trying to process what happened to him, including being charged with murder in the self-defense slaying and then finally having the rap dropped amid widespread outcry, said Francisco Marte, the head of a bodega association that has been helping the worker.

“He is taking a hiatus right now,” Marte said. “He went upstate to get away from everything” before he heads to the DR.

...

On July 1, Alba was working behind the counter at the Hamilton Heights bodega when he got into an argument with a woman after she couldn’t pay for a bag of chips.

The woman then sent for her boyfriend, Austin Simon, 35, who came behind the counter and attacked Alba, leading the worker to grab a knife and stab the man to death.

Alba called police, and when they arrived, they arrested him on second-degree murder charges...On July 19, Manhattan District Attorney Alvin Bragg finally agreed to drop the charges against Alba, conceding there wasn’t enough evidence to prove the worker “was not justified in his use of deadly physical force,” his office wrote in a motion.
